== Pro Wrestling ==
* For an angle in [[WCW]], Bill [[Goldberg]] was required to punch through a real glass window of a limousine. He was originally supposed to conceal a small piece of pipe in his hand to aid with the punching, but after the cameras started rolling he lost it and decided to punch through the window with his bare fist. A shard of glass caused a huge gash down his forearm and he was out of action for months. * In a [[World Wrestling Entertainment|WWE]] example, there was the spot during King Of The Ring 2001 where [[Kurt Angle]] attempted to suplex [[Shane McMahon]] through a sheet of glass. The glass did not break and Shane landed right on his head. It took them three tries before the glass finally broke. Moments later they tried the same thing again with the same amount of success.
** If you listen to the match commentary on the DVD with Shane and Kurt they talk about this, and proving that he's actually got a bit of badass in him, Shane apparently told Kurt once they were through the first one to just fling him head-first through the glass on the way out. He did, and it looked awesome.
